AI Safety Analysis for the 2022 Audi Rs 7

The 2022 Audi RS 7 currently presents a very clean safety record according to NHTSA data, with 0 total complaints, 0 crashes, 0 fires, 0 injuries, and 0 deaths reported. This indicates an excellent initial safety performance from a consumer complaint perspective. However, it is important to note that the vehicle has not undergone NHTSA's official crash test ratings, as all categories (Overall, Frontal, Side, Rollover) are listed as 'N/A'. This means there is no independent government crash test data available to assess its structural safety performance. The vehicle has one active recall, identified as 'BACK OVER PREVENTION: SENSING SYSTEM: CAMERA'. This recall, issued by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. (Audi), affects certain 2019-2026 vehicles, including the 2022 RS 7. The core issue is a software error that may prevent the rearview camera image from displaying. The consequence of this defect is a reduced driver's view behind the vehicle, which increases the risk of a crash. Owners should ensure this recall has been addressed by a dealership. Given the lack of crash test data, the overall safety picture is primarily based on the absence of consumer-reported incidents. While the recall is a significant safety concern that needs to be rectified, the complete absence of other complaints is a positive indicator for a relatively new model. Prospective buyers should prioritize confirming the recall repair.

Has the 2022 Audi RS 7 been recalled?

Yes, the 2022 Audi RS 7 has one recall (NHTSA ID: 23V-655) concerning the 'BACK OVER PREVENTION: SENSING SYSTEM: CAMERA'. This recall addresses a software error that may prevent the rearview camera image from displaying.

What are the crash test ratings for the 2022 Audi RS 7?

The 2022 Audi RS 7 has not received official crash test ratings from NHTSA. All categories, including Overall, Frontal, Side, and Rollover, are listed as 'N/A'.
